Job description

Drive Innovation Through Robotics and Automation.
Position Summary

Step into a high-impact role where engineering meets innovation. The Manufacturing Engineer – Robotics will design, program, and optimize advanced robotic automation systems that directly shape production performance. You’ll play a key role in driving efficiency, improving quality, enhancing safety, and increasing reliability across the manufacturing floor.

This is a hands‑on, forward‑thinking position for someone who thrives on solving complex problems, working with cutting‑edge robotics, and continuously improving how things are made. The ideal candidate blends strong manufacturing engineering fundamentals with real‑world experience in robotics, automation controls, and process improvement.

Key Responsibilities
Robotics & Automation
  • Design and implement robotic manufacturing cells and automated production systems.
  • Program, troubleshoot, and optimize industrial robots (FANUC, ABB, KUKA, Yaskawa, Universal Robots).
  • Integrate robots with PLCs, HMIs, vision systems, conveyors, and other automation equipment.
  • Support applications including welding, material handling, assembly, palletizing, machine tending, and inspection.
  • Develop and maintain robotic documentation, backups, and standards.
Manufacturing Engineering
  • Identify automation opportunities to improve throughput, quality, and labor efficiency.
  • Lead process improvement initiatives using Lean Manufacturing and Six Sigma methodologies.
  • Develop work instructions, process flows, PFMEAs, and standard operating procedures.
  • Support new product launches with scalable, repeatable manufacturing processes.
  • Conduct cycle time studies and capacity analysis.
Troubleshooting & Maintenance Support
  • Diagnose and resolve robotic and automation issues to minimize downtime.
  • Partner with maintenance and production teams to improve uptime and equipment reliability.
  • Support root cause analysis and corrective actions.
Project Management
  • Lead automation projects from concept through installation and production launch.
  • Collaborate with vendors, integrators, and internal stakeholders.
  • Develop project timelines, budgets, and technical specifications.
  • Support Factory Acceptance Testing (FAT) and Site Acceptance Testing (SAT).
Safety & Compliance
  • Ensure robotic systems meet OSHA, ANSI/RIA, and company safety standards.
  • Participate in risk assessments and machine safeguarding reviews.
  • Promote a strong culture of safety and continuous improvement.
